Adaptive Meta-learner via Gradient Similarity for Few-shot Text Classification (2022.coling-1)

Challenge: Existing methods for few-shot text classification suffer from overfitting due to the lack of matching between the few amount of samples and complicated models.
Approach: They propose a method to improve model generalization ability to a new task by leveraging a meta-learner via gradient similarity method.
Outcome: The proposed method improves few-shot text classification performance on several benchmarks.
DAC-Bench: A Decision-Aware Benchmark for Compositional Mobile GUI Tasks (2026.acl-long)

Challenge: Existing benchmarks focus on short, linear workflows and step-level accuracy, highlighting performance degradations.
Approach: They propose a decision-aware benchmark with compositional tasks comprising 830 episodes and 11,345 action steps across 35 applications on Android and iOS.
Outcome: The proposed benchmarks show performance degradation and branch correctness issues in 7 different GUI agents.
OneRec-Think: In-Text Reasoning for Generative Recommendation (2026.acl-long)

Challenge: Existing generative models lack the capacity for explicit and controllable reasoning, a key advantage of LLMs.
Approach: They propose a framework that integrates dialogue, reasoning, and personalized recommendation.
Outcome: Experiments across public benchmarks show state-of-the-art performance.
